#fd160d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fd160d is composed of 99.2% red, 8.6%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.3%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 2.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 52.2%. #fd160d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c1a with #fb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

#fd160d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fd160d has RGB values of R:253, G:22,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.95,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16586253.

Shades and Tints of #fd160d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0000 is the darkest color, while #fff7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d160d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c7e7e is the less saturated color, while #fd160d is the most saturated one.
